What is an architecture humanitarian?

An Architecture Humanitarian job involves using architectural skills to design and build structures that support communities in crisis or need. This can include disaster relief housing, refugee shelters, or sustainable infrastructure for underprivileged areas. Professionals in this role often collaborate with NGOs, governments, and local communities to create safe, functional, and culturally appropriate spaces. The goal is to improve living conditions while considering environmental impact, resource availability, and social dynamics.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of an architecture humanitarian?

As an Architecture Humanitarian, your day-to-day work often involves assessing community needs, developing site plans, and designing structures that address social, environmental, and cultural challenges. You’ll collaborate closely with local stakeholders, NGOs, engineers, and construction teams to ensure that projects are both sustainable and context-sensitive. Field visits, community workshops, and adapting designs to rapidly changing circumstances are common parts of the job. This role requires balancing technical design skills with creativity and empathy to deliver meaningful built environments in underserved regions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the architecture humanitarian position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Architecture Humanitarian, you need a degree in architecture or a related field, experience in sustainable design, and a passion for socially responsible projects. Familiarity with software like AutoCAD, SketchUp, and GIS, plus knowledge of building codes and LEED or WELL certification, is valuable. Cultural sensitivity, adaptability, and strong collaboration skills help you work effectively with diverse communities and interdisciplinary teams. These attributes are vital for delivering impactful, context-appropriate solutions that address urgent needs in humanitarian or post-disaster environments.

Job description

Welcome to Planet. We believe in using space to help life on Earth.

Planet designs, builds, and operates the largest constellation of imaging satellites in history. This constellation delivers an unprecedented dataset of empirical information via a revolutionary cloud-based platform to authoritative figures in commercial, environmental, and humanitarian sectors. We are both a space company and data company all rolled into one.

Customers and users across the globe use Planet's data to develop new technologies, drive revenue, power research, and solve our world's toughest obstacles.

As we control every component of hardware design, manufacturing, data processing, and software engineering, our office is a truly inspiring mix of experts from a variety of domains.

We have a people-centric approach toward culture and community and we strive to iterate in a way that puts our team members first and prepares our company for growth. Join Planet and be a part of our mission to change the way people see the world.

Planet is a global company with employees working remotely world wide and joining us from offices in San Francisco, Washington DC, Germany, Austria, Slovenia, and The Netherlands.

About the Role:

As a Senior Data Engineer (DE) at Planet, you will own, architect and build production, enterprise-scale data ecosystems using modern cloud technologies, to power mission-critical, customer-facing products. You will act as a strategic partner to cross-functional stakeholders, translating complex requirements into robust, scalable solutions. You will build and design data solutions end to end: from high-level architecture and implementation to CI/CD, orchestration automated QA, and seamless integration into production systems. You'll be a senior member of the Data Team within the Software Engineering organization, which is made up of data scientists, engineers and analysts working on similar tasks across Planet domains.

Your scope will focus on the architecture and evolution of data systems supporting our global monitoring products. These products are vital offerings designed to provide persistent, high-cadence monitoring and active intelligence, particularly for our Defence and Intelligence customers. You will collaborate closely with leadership across Product and Engineering to ensure some of our most sophisticated customers have the data required for global security and rapid decision-making. This role is ideal for an expert data engineer looking to lead the evolution of complex systems and deliver transformative technology to the defense sector. The ideal candidate is an independent operator who thrives in a dynamic, global environment and is deeply passionate about Planet's mission and national security solutions.

This is a full-time, hybrid role which will require you to work from our Washington DC or Denver CO office 3 days per week.

Impact You'll Own:

  • Architect and oversee robust, high-availability data pipelines while establishing the standards for maintaining, troubleshooting, and optimizing existing ecosystems.
  • Collaborate with global product, commercial and engineering leads and peers to design and execute a long-term data strategy for products in your scope.
  • Drive high-level mentorship, technical design reviews, and architectural integrity across the Data Team while setting standards for code quality.

What You Bring:

  • 10+ years of relevant experience in data engineering with a track record of technical leadership.
  • Bachelor's degree in a relevant field.
  • Expertise in designing and implementing end-to-end data architectures for global-scale, customer-facing solutions, with a focus on data integrity and efficiency.
  • Expert-level proficiency in Python and SQL for complex ETL/ELT pipeline construction, including event-driven data architectures.
  • Proactive, self-starter mindset with the ability to lead problem-solving initiatives in a dynamic, high-stakes environment.
  • Exceptional communication skills, with the ability to translate between technical execution and high-level business requirements.
  • Deep experience in maintaining enterprise-grade, peer-reviewed codebases and advanced CI/CD workflows using GitLab CI, Docker, and Kubernetes.
  • Significant experience with cloud-native architectures (GCP preferred).
  • Experience tuning storage formats such as Parquet to ensure sub-second query performance for consumers.

What Makes You Stand Out:

  • Experience using modern data tooling (e.g. dbt) for pipeline inputs to customer-facing production systems.
  • Experience leveraging Infrastructure as Code tooling (e.g. Terraform) to manage cloud architecture.
  • Experience architecting solutions for geospatial datasets.
  • Knowledge of earth observation and/or satellite operation concepts.
